As a result, files that had modifications might not be displayed by git-gui. Even worse, files that are already in the index might not be displayed, which makes git-gui unusable. This fix changes the meaning of gui.maxfilesdisplayed, making it a soft limit that only applies to "_O" files, i.e. files that are "Untracked, not staged".
